{"id":2158086,"date":"2025-11-15T05:03:14","date_gmt":"2025-11-15T05:03:14","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/celebrity.land\/en\/?p=2158086"},"modified":"2025-11-15T05:03:14","modified_gmt":"2025-11-15T05:03:14","slug":"country-music-hall-of-fame-features-iconic-music-made-in-muscle-shoals-alabama","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/celebrity.land\/en\/country-music-hall-of-fame-features-iconic-music-made-in-muscle-shoals-alabama\/","title":{"rendered":"Country Music Hall of Fame features iconic music made in Muscle Shoals, Alabama"},"content":{"rendered":"<p><\/p>\n<div>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"UNHBNEGHWZHD5FZ42HR7LZJECM\">The Country Music Hall of Fame wasn\u2019t sure they were going to get the piano. The Apollo baby grand that was at <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/01\/rick_hall_fame_muscle_shoals.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/01\/rick_hall_fame_muscle_shoals.html\">FAME Studios<\/a> from 1961 to 1970. The piano <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/08\/aretha_franklin_died.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/08\/aretha_franklin_died.html\">Aretha Franklin<\/a> played on \u201cI Never Loved a Man (The Way I Love You),\u201d her breakthrough hit, recorded at FAME in 1967. The piano played on virtually every FAME recording with piano on it from the studio\u2019s most hallowed era.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"NA4QOTGWXJGRTMIVZCE3VRYSC4\">Country Music Hall of Fame curator R.J. Smith says, \u201cThe whole family [of late<a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/01\/rick_hall_fame_muscle_shoals.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/01\/rick_hall_fame_muscle_shoals.html\"> FAME Studios owner\/producer Rick Hall<\/a>] has been incredibly generous with their time, with their thoughts, with their artifacts,\u201d for use in <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/cmhfm.emlnk1.com\/lt.php?x=3DZy~GDFIXOfD88s-w68UBR03HEgvdMhjxtljHXLVnOdD5B_z0y.0uNz2HBzjdLyjvYxXHcWJ3Oa6X3\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\">new exhibit \u201cMuscle Shoals: Low Rhythm Rising,\u201d which opens November 14 at the Nashville museum<\/a>.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"AJAO6NWSDNEKJMZM66DOKZOBFE\">Smith continues, \u201cThe one thing that there was reluctance, perhaps just because it\u2019s such a big thing, was that piano. We didn\u2019t press it, and we\u2019re so grateful that it happened. It fills the room and it kind of defines the exhibit like nothing else I could think of might. It was a big ask, and we waited for a while holding our breaths.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"MO7RQT5JXFHGZFW2IS3UHOMXFY\">Curator Michael Gray adds, \u201c[Rick Hall\u2019s son and FAME general manager] Rodney Hall and his mother Linda Hall, they\u2019ve been extremely supportive.\u201d <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"CR7GNSEMI5GB5CUNTKFSBXDSLA\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/10\/the-story-behind-rolling-stones-drummers-epic-muscle-shoals-tribute-concert.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/10\/the-story-behind-rolling-stones-drummers-epic-muscle-shoals-tribute-concert.html\"><b>The story behind Rolling Stones drummer\u2019s epic Muscle Shoals tribute<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"EF57FIIFO5D7DKUJN2SXHLUNJ4\">For the new Muscle Shoals exhibit, the hall of fame conducted more than 20 oral history film interviews with different Shoals area musicians. Many of them were done in the studio at FAME.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"EPTDDMRHLNGKTLKT524JBVLUOY\">\u201cThey just opened up the doors and let us use the studio, gratis,\u201d Grays says. \u201cBut when it came to the piano, they had to just think about that for a minute, just because they\u2019re still giving tours there at FAME and need to have neat materials to show their visitors. And that piano means a lot to the family, to Linda. And they just wanted to think about it for a minute before they said yes. But they eventually did.\u201d<\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"FAME Studios.\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/NSYICXURXVDLNJO7V7NNXRUC64.jpg?auth=694b6c3a9d44655dcd5ee745f366b1e688f95cf9e82e51bc01dbb1c3d8a48540&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/NSYICXURXVDLNJO7V7NNXRUC64.jpg?auth=694b6c3a9d44655dcd5ee745f366b1e688f95cf9e82e51bc01dbb1c3d8a48540&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/NSYICXURXVDLNJO7V7NNXRUC64.jpg?auth=694b6c3a9d44655dcd5ee745f366b1e688f95cf9e82e51bc01dbb1c3d8a48540&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/NSYICXURXVDLNJO7V7NNXRUC64.jpg?auth=694b6c3a9d44655dcd5ee745f366b1e688f95cf9e82e51bc01dbb1c3d8a48540&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">Aretha Franklin played this Apollo baby grand piano when she recorded her breakout pop and R&amp;B hit, \u201cI Never Loved a Man (The Way I Love You),\u201d at FAME Studios in 1967. The instrument was in use at the studio from 1961 to 1970.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"DFYTPHBQLVC3HDWZU5GXUQZJPY\">The baby grand is positioned in the center of the Country Hall of Fame\u2019s 5,000 square-foot exhibit. \u201cLow Rhythm Rising\u201d focuses on the vibrant 1960s and 1970s recording scene in Muscle Shoals, at studios like FAME and Sheffield\u2019s <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/02\/how_muscle_shoals_sound_tours.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/02\/how_muscle_shoals_sound_tours.html\">Muscle Shoals Sound<\/a> and Norala\/Quinvy Recording.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"NLZD3UOOIFEFPHFVFKHSGFK5DU\">An otherwise humble agrarian North Alabama area at the time, Muscle Shoals was an unlikely recording hotbed. But thanks to visionaries like Rick Hall and Atlantic Records executive\/producer Jerry Wexler, a bevy of talented studio musicians, including collectives known as Muscle Shoals Rhythm Section,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/12\/muscle_shoals_has_got_the_swam.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/12\/muscle_shoals_has_got_the_swam.html\">The Swampers<\/a> and <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\">FAME Gang<\/a>, and an absence of big city distractions and temptations, the Shoals became just that.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"6IZFWI35EZC7DOI2XZ6PBF5MKY\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/12\/the_20_best_songs_ever_recorde.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/12\/the_20_best_songs_ever_recorde.html\"><b>The 20 best songs ever recorded in Muscle Shoals<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"7SFCC442ANCB3OQ7YTL7DAIPS4\">A staggering list of legendary artists, from R&amp;B (Franklin, Etta James, Wilson Pickett,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/02\/when_a_man_loves_a_woman_50th.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2016\/02\/when_a_man_loves_a_woman_50th.html\">Percy Sledge<\/a>, Staple Singers, etc.) to rock (<a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/12\/mick_jagger_slept_here_marker.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/12\/mick_jagger_slept_here_marker.html\">Rolling Stones<\/a>,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/almost-famous-southern-rock-bands-connection-to-a-classic-hit.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/almost-famous-southern-rock-bands-connection-to-a-classic-hit.html\">Bob Seger<\/a>,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/08\/bob_dylan_muscle_shoals.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/08\/bob_dylan_muscle_shoals.html\">Bob Dylan<\/a>) to pop (Paul Simon, Rod Stewart,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/10\/rock-roll-hall-of-famer-chers-muscle-shoals-roots.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/10\/rock-roll-hall-of-famer-chers-muscle-shoals-roots.html\">Cher<\/a>, The Osmonds) to country (Bobbie Gentry, Willie Nelson, Mac Davis) and beyond (reggae star Jimmy Cliff), recorded classic tracks in Muscle Shoals.<\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/IRIEBVV355HQJB4L6XXAZHPQ4A.jpg?auth=61844a5beaab8b2d7c5fca2bb43e96764e607fd1d1a9ec472bf118ed3e893bb9&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/IRIEBVV355HQJB4L6XXAZHPQ4A.jpg?auth=61844a5beaab8b2d7c5fca2bb43e96764e607fd1d1a9ec472bf118ed3e893bb9&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/IRIEBVV355HQJB4L6XXAZHPQ4A.jpg?auth=61844a5beaab8b2d7c5fca2bb43e96764e607fd1d1a9ec472bf118ed3e893bb9&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/IRIEBVV355HQJB4L6XXAZHPQ4A.jpg?auth=61844a5beaab8b2d7c5fca2bb43e96764e607fd1d1a9ec472bf118ed3e893bb9&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">Built in 1964, this was one of two sunburst-finish Fender Stratocasters used by Duane Allman when he was a session musician at FAME Studios and Muscle Shoals Sound Studios, from 1968 to 1969. He traded this guitar to another Muscle Shoals musician, Mickey Buckins, who used it at sessions and performances.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"HNES2XKL7JABDFZJ5HIY23D62A\">In addition to that FAME Studios piano, notable objects exhibited in \u201cLow Rhythm Rising\u201d include a 1964 Fender Stratocaster played by <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/08\/duane-allman-guitar-with-alabama-roots-sells-for-125-million.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/08\/duane-allman-guitar-with-alabama-roots-sells-for-125-million.html\">Duane Allman<\/a>, during the soon-to-be <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/04\/allman_brothers_song_rankings.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/04\/allman_brothers_song_rankings.html\">Allman Brothers Band<\/a> guitar hero\u2019s time as a Muscle Shoals studio musician in 1968 and 1969. Allman traded the Strat to another key Shoals studio musician,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\">Mickey Buckins<\/a>, who lent it for the exhibit. <\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/VYEM6TPQVJCHLCUXRYBRW4EOT4.jpg?auth=8b9eb6a499390b7bd1808bab4034ef5ab22ddbde1bdee8e8efaf55c7cf078888&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/VYEM6TPQVJCHLCUXRYBRW4EOT4.jpg?auth=8b9eb6a499390b7bd1808bab4034ef5ab22ddbde1bdee8e8efaf55c7cf078888&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/VYEM6TPQVJCHLCUXRYBRW4EOT4.jpg?auth=8b9eb6a499390b7bd1808bab4034ef5ab22ddbde1bdee8e8efaf55c7cf078888&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/VYEM6TPQVJCHLCUXRYBRW4EOT4.jpg?auth=8b9eb6a499390b7bd1808bab4034ef5ab22ddbde1bdee8e8efaf55c7cf078888&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">This 1957 Fender Telecaster belonged to Muscle Shoals session guitarist, producer, and recording engineer Pete Carr. The instrument was also used by Duane Allman when he and Carr were members of Hour Glass, the Los Angeles\u2013based R&amp;B band that included Gregg Allman, prior to the formation of the Allman Brothers Band.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"VF2MTDGBTNFMHHB6KYBPHMT5O4\">There\u2019s also a 1957 Fender Telecaster that Allman played in his pre Allman Brothers band Hour Glass. The Tele was also used by <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/06\/muscle-shoals-unsung-guitar-genius.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/06\/muscle-shoals-unsung-guitar-genius.html\">Pete Carr, known for his lead guitar on Bob Seger\u2019s hit \u201cMainstreet.\u201d<\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"3JSJFTR2OZEZBHB3SIOBX5BPKY\">Staple Singers\u2019 \u201cI\u2019ll Take Your There\u201d and \u201cRespect Yourself\u201d are two of the most enduring songs cut at Muscle Shoals Sound. A 1970 Fender Telecaster played by Pop Staples when Staple Singers performed the song \u201cThe Weight\u201d with proto-Americana icons The Band at their final concert in 1970, as seen in director Martin Scorsese\u2019s \u201cThe Last Waltz,\u201d widely regarded as one of rock\u2019s greatest documentaries. <\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/N3MIEFCTZJFMPO4UFOYXZXR7RU.jpg?auth=12cc3c98a37f7ae634864bb2f5ae4df2358e3aae4ab39c25a07f5467802ef66d&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/N3MIEFCTZJFMPO4UFOYXZXR7RU.jpg?auth=12cc3c98a37f7ae634864bb2f5ae4df2358e3aae4ab39c25a07f5467802ef66d&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/N3MIEFCTZJFMPO4UFOYXZXR7RU.jpg?auth=12cc3c98a37f7ae634864bb2f5ae4df2358e3aae4ab39c25a07f5467802ef66d&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/N3MIEFCTZJFMPO4UFOYXZXR7RU.jpg?auth=12cc3c98a37f7ae634864bb2f5ae4df2358e3aae4ab39c25a07f5467802ef66d&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">Muscle Shoals session musician Roger Hawkins, the drummer in the Swampers, used this Slingerland snare drum with his first band, Spooner &amp; the Spoons. The group, which included Spooner Oldham, Dan Penn and Junior Lowe, recorded at FAME Studios, circa1965.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"MMULABSDRRBL7CVCSZRUJ2MNBQ\">The exhibit also boasts Slingerland snare drum played by late great Swampers drummer <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/08\/swampers-drum-legends-hot-beats-and-cold-winter.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/08\/swampers-drum-legends-hot-beats-and-cold-winter.html\">Roger Hawkins<\/a> early in his career. Hawkins supplied the beats on Muscle Shoals essentials like Wilson Pickett\u2019s \u201cLand Of 1000 Dances\u201d and \u201cMustang Sally.\u201d Percy Sledge\u2019s \u201cWhen a Man Loves a Woman\u201d and Bob Seger\u2019s \u201cOld Time Rock and Roll.\u201d Clarence Carter\u2019s \u201cSlip Away\u201d and Staple Singers\u2019 \u201cI\u2019ll Take You There,\u201d too.<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"UBA32JDDANHUZNU7L22IY776LU\">Aretha\u2019s FAME session was cut short due to a kerfuffle between her entourage and someone at the studio. But Atlantic Records\u2019 Jerry Wexler thought so much of Muscle Shoals musicians, he\u2019d bring Hawkins and others to New York to back Franklin in the studio for hits like \u201cRespect,\u201d \u201cChain of Fools\u201d and \u201cThink,\u201d among others. <\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FCNGEIRWKRHKXPZTJCL5WELKIM.jpg?auth=23cee2510938d80c84213fc47febd99d12bdf59145504fb692a487fc6e1d3367&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FCNGEIRWKRHKXPZTJCL5WELKIM.jpg?auth=23cee2510938d80c84213fc47febd99d12bdf59145504fb692a487fc6e1d3367&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FCNGEIRWKRHKXPZTJCL5WELKIM.jpg?auth=23cee2510938d80c84213fc47febd99d12bdf59145504fb692a487fc6e1d3367&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FCNGEIRWKRHKXPZTJCL5WELKIM.jpg?auth=23cee2510938d80c84213fc47febd99d12bdf59145504fb692a487fc6e1d3367&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">Wilson Pickett wore this jumpsuit on the cover of his 1971 LP, The Best of Wilson Pickett, Vol. II. The album included Pickett\u2019s 1969 hit version of the Beatles\u2019 \u201cHey Jude,\u201d recorded at FAME Studios with backing by guitarist Duane Allman and the Swampers.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"QNJYATDENBC2FCSOHDLVSUR5FI\">There\u2019s also clothing in the Country Hall of Fame\u2019s Muscle Shoals exhibit. There\u2019s the black jumpsuit Wilson Pickett wore on the cover photo for his volume two best-of compilation from 1971. That album contained his 1969 R&amp;B version of The Beatles \u201cHey Jude,\u201d recorded at Fame and backed by Duane Allman and the Swampers.<\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XD2MIC7VZJCFVA52NNLKLMTQXY.jpg?auth=ed69c4cc751b8100b2c81e1429f238bb3d41b367a5cb2f610fd3eaf6e735cd00&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XD2MIC7VZJCFVA52NNLKLMTQXY.jpg?auth=ed69c4cc751b8100b2c81e1429f238bb3d41b367a5cb2f610fd3eaf6e735cd00&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XD2MIC7VZJCFVA52NNLKLMTQXY.jpg?auth=ed69c4cc751b8100b2c81e1429f238bb3d41b367a5cb2f610fd3eaf6e735cd00&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XD2MIC7VZJCFVA52NNLKLMTQXY.jpg?auth=ed69c4cc751b8100b2c81e1429f238bb3d41b367a5cb2f610fd3eaf6e735cd00&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">Candi Staton wore this custom-made buckskin jacket and pants, embellished with feathers and leather fringe, in the 1970s.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"XTSYFOEJKNCVRFWJA4TAEAWGFU\">In all the great singers Rick Hall worked with at FAME,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/07\/candi_staton_2014_wc_handy_mus.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/07\/candi_staton_2014_wc_handy_mus.html\">Candi Staton<\/a> was his favorite. Known for classic soul tracks like \u201cIn The Ghetto,\u201d Staton\u2019s custom-made buckskin suit, adorned with feathers and fringe, is on display in \u201cLow Rhythm Rising.\u201d As is a blue jacket worn in the \u201860s by <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/07\/shoals-songwriting-icon-talks-aretha-royalty-checks.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\">Dan Penn, the Shoals songwriter who had a hand in writing hits like Aretha\u2019s \u201cDo Right Woman, Do Right Man,\u201d James Carr\u2019s \u201cThe Dark End of the Street,\u201d and James &amp; Bobby Purify\u2019s \u201cI\u2019m Your Puppet.\u201d<\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"47NUPI6A5JAQRFDFKSINHVXNFY\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/04\/the-horn-arranging-secrets-of-muscle-shoals-aretha-hits.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/04\/the-horn-arranging-secrets-of-muscle-shoals-aretha-hits.html\"><b>The horn section secrets of Muscle Shoals, Aretha hits<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"UOHB7CC7QJA4FNI4SY6OOW5MAI\">Muscle Shoals music is most often associated with vintage R&amp;B made there. But country music has been pivotal in Shoals success too. right down to the most accurate description of its signature sound: Country soul.<\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FNTVKEBJQVBDJMYR6VU4ZOQP2A.jpg?auth=9db9c386d55f32f85a007dd3f4326e10d76bdfa7e4fbc4858f01b283ff605303&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FNTVKEBJQVBDJMYR6VU4ZOQP2A.jpg?auth=9db9c386d55f32f85a007dd3f4326e10d76bdfa7e4fbc4858f01b283ff605303&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FNTVKEBJQVBDJMYR6VU4ZOQP2A.jpg?auth=9db9c386d55f32f85a007dd3f4326e10d76bdfa7e4fbc4858f01b283ff605303&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/FNTVKEBJQVBDJMYR6VU4ZOQP2A.jpg?auth=9db9c386d55f32f85a007dd3f4326e10d76bdfa7e4fbc4858f01b283ff605303&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">This fiddle belonged to FAME Studios owner, producer and songwriter Rick Hall. (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"5EAPPMZ5YNHWHBZGFPABTXUREE\">Before his FAME days, Rick Hall was a local country musician. The \u201cLow Rhythm Rising\u201d exhibit includes a fiddle Hall played at square dances when he was a teenager.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"5NPADDQ4DFB7HM2UEG76D2QNHI\"><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/Mac%20McAnally\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/Mac%20McAnally\/\">Mac McAnally<\/a>, longtime guitarist in <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/jimmy%20buffett\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/jimmy%20buffett\/\">Jimmy Buffett\u2019s<\/a> Coral Reefer Band, loaned the hall of fame his 1967 Martin acoustic. McAnally used it during his time as a Muscle Shoals studio musician. <\/p>\n<figure class=\"article__image\">\n<div class=\"article__image-wrapper\"><img fetchpriority=\"low\" lo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Muscle Shoals\" class=\"article__image-content\" src=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XP63AQXGVRBHXPVQN5L46D6TBE.jpg?auth=64e9f12627908d1869d3f3b65c7cc4c2f57fb6e4a4dd1290a5119dfa0d7c02f2&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XP63AQXGVRBHXPVQN5L46D6TBE.jpg?auth=64e9f12627908d1869d3f3b65c7cc4c2f57fb6e4a4dd1290a5119dfa0d7c02f2&amp;width=500&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 500w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XP63AQXGVRBHXPVQN5L46D6TBE.jpg?auth=64e9f12627908d1869d3f3b65c7cc4c2f57fb6e4a4dd1290a5119dfa0d7c02f2&amp;width=800&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 800w, https:\/\/www.al.com\/resizer\/v2\/XP63AQXGVRBHXPVQN5L46D6TBE.jpg?auth=64e9f12627908d1869d3f3b65c7cc4c2f57fb6e4a4dd1290a5119dfa0d7c02f2&amp;width=1280&amp;smart=true&amp;quality=90 1280w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 500px) 100vw, (max-width: 800px) 80vw, 60vw\"\/><figcaption class=\"article__image-caption\"><span class=\"article__mm-image-caption-text\">An early draft of handwritten lyrics by Mac Davis to \u201cBaby Don\u2019t Get Hooked on Me.\u201d (Photo by Bob Delevante for the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um)<span class=\"article__mm-image-credit\">Bob Delevante<\/span><\/span><\/figcaption><\/div>\n<\/figure>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"7FGDN6S3SZHZDKA5NUYE27KCJI\">There\u2019s also an early handwritten draft of Mac Davis\u2019 lyrics to his number one hit \u201cBaby Don\u2019t Get Hooked on Me.\u201c Davis penned the song as a response to Rick Hall telling him none of his new songs they were working on had a hook.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"JYYUKOXWXBDQJEGBDJ6G7VYORQ\">Curator Michael Gray says, \u201cWe like to look at how country music, even though this exhibit does have a lot of just straight ahead country music in it, there is all these other connections where country music is rubbing against soul and R&amp;B and rock and pop. And we love telling those stories.\u201d <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"SVRTLSGBFVHWVL2LCKOHH2OXYI\">Curator R.J. Smith adds, \u201cThere\u2019s this story in Rick Hall\u2019s book, in his autobiography where he\u2019s talking about Etta James coming to record \u2018I\u2019d Rather Go Blind,\u2019 and he\u2019s like, telling her to sing it like [country singer] Kitty Wells would. And we\u2019ve got [Shoals keyboardist\/songwriter] <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2015\/08\/the_swampers_spooner_oldham_ta.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2015\/08\/the_swampers_spooner_oldham_ta.html\">Spooner Oldham<\/a> talking about how Percy Sledge sort of had a nasal country tone to his voice.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"M6NV46MUPFD23EOLS5JFT7ZHEQ\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/01\/muscle_shoals_recording_sessio.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/01\/muscle_shoals_recording_sessio.html\"><b>20 Muscle Shoals music connections that might surprise you<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"JN2BRBFEO5G6DFMJHFHULV2JVA\">Although Muscle Shoals music is being featured in a museum, Muscle Shoals music <i>itself<\/i> isn\u2019t a museum. The area has seen a resurgence in recent decades, boosted by popular <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2023\/04\/how-muscle-shoals-documentary-changed-muscle-shoals-musics-future.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2023\/04\/how-muscle-shoals-documentary-changed-muscle-shoals-musics-future.html\">2013 documentary film, \u201cMuscle Shoals.\u201d<\/a> Artists like <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/09\/watch-jack-white-record-at-muscle-shoals-fame-studios.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/09\/watch-jack-white-record-at-muscle-shoals-fame-studios.html\">Jack White<\/a>, <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/09\/post_377.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2017\/09\/post_377.html\">Gregg Allman<\/a>, Aerosmith\u2019s <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/07\/steven_tyler_fame_studios_musc.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2018\/07\/steven_tyler_fame_studios_musc.html\">Steven Tyler<\/a>, Heart\u2019s <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2022\/04\/ann-wilson-talks-new-muscle-shoals-album-led-zeppelin-hearts-classics-and-future.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2022\/04\/ann-wilson-talks-new-muscle-shoals-album-led-zeppelin-hearts-classics-and-future.html\">Ann Wilson<\/a> and <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/11\/new-chris-stapleton-album-features-muscle-shoals-track.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/11\/new-chris-stapleton-album-features-muscle-shoals-track.html\">Chris Stapleton<\/a> have recorded there since then. <\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"YPHA5D6BPFGP5OKYITAPCYKM54\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2022\/08\/10-times-rock-stars-covered-classic-muscle-shoals-songs.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2022\/08\/10-times-rock-stars-covered-classic-muscle-shoals-songs.html\"><b>10 times rock stars covered classic Muscle Shoals songs<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"PMUL7FKONVEMLPNAHCHY6RHHQ4\">Former longtime Muscle Shoals resident <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/jason%20isbell\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/jason%20isbell\/\">Jason Isbell<\/a> has become one of the most, if not the most, acclaimed songwriters of his time. Isbell loaned his 1956 Martin acoustic guitar, used on <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/02\/which-alabama-music-star-has-the-most-grammy-wins-the-answer-might-surprise-you.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2024\/02\/which-alabama-music-star-has-the-most-grammy-wins-the-answer-might-surprise-you.html\">Grammy winning<\/a> Isbell albums \u201cSomething More Than Free\u201d and \u201cThe Nashville Sound,\u201d for \u201cLow Rhythm Rising.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"USGHDQIIPRA6TAI7CM6HXH2LZE\">Isbell was a staff songwriter at FAME before joining <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2021\/11\/acclaimed-southern-rock-bands-complete-saga-told-for-first-time.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2021\/11\/acclaimed-southern-rock-bands-complete-saga-told-for-first-time.html\">Drive By Truckers<\/a>, a rock band led by Shoals native <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/10\/patterson-hood-talks-new-drive-by-truckers-album-eddie-van-halen-jason-isbell.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2020\/10\/patterson-hood-talks-new-drive-by-truckers-album-eddie-van-halen-jason-isbell.html\">Patterson Hood<\/a>, the son of <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/09\/post_266.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/entertainment\/2014\/09\/post_266.html\">Swampers bassist David Hood<\/a>, and later achieving solo stardom.<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"QZELT7YFBJDTZA7UUQPXZXIR3A\">Now a Nashville area resident, Isbell narrated a YouTube video promoting the Country Hall of Fame\u2019s exhibit. He wrote the forward to the book accompanying \u201cLow Rhythm Rising,\u201d too.<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"W37UZNNI6REXXFVQKWPZBHC2E4\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/07\/alabama-music-legends-secret-life-with-alternative-rock-icons.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/07\/alabama-music-legends-secret-life-with-alternative-rock-icons.html\"><b>Alabama music legend\u2019s other life with alternative-rock icons<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"AHJZSHO3YNC7FLXQ5OTVR6PQMU\">In that forward, Isbell wrote, \u201cListening to the music that had been made in Muscle Shoals was really the first experience that I had with the inner life of people who didn\u2019t look exactly like me. If that hadn\u2019t happened, I could have been a totally different type of person than I am now.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"U2SNWX7TXRHHLFX3FAZVNLOSEU\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/03\/iconic-musicians-sly-tonight-show-tribute-to-muscle-shoals-rolling-stones.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/03\/iconic-musicians-sly-tonight-show-tribute-to-muscle-shoals-rolling-stones.html\"><b>Jason Isbell\u2019s sly \u2018Tonight Show\u2019 tribute to Muscle Shoals, Rolling Stones<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"RAFZRQFAXRHPHG5HS7QQ7TLNIY\">On Thursday, the night before the exhibit opened, Isbell was part of a reception at the Country Hall of Fame. He performed solo acoustic versions of Shoals-made songs, including Arthur Alexander\u2019s \u201cYou Better Move On,\u201d Rolling Stones\u2019 \u201cWild Horses\u201d and Paul Simon\u2019s \u201cKodachrome.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"6N4DFQVL2VESVBPDJ57HDFFPX4\"><b>RELATED: <\/b><a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/04\/the-muscle-shoals-backing-singers-who-help-stars-shine.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2019\/04\/the-muscle-shoals-backing-singers-who-help-stars-shine.html\"><b>The Muscle Shoals backing singers who help stars shine<\/b><\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"B2EFO5DUSBDADEVRA4RXQFFY4U\">The hall of fame has more events to promote the exhibit. On November 15, there\u2019s a 12 p.m. songwriter session with Dan Penn and Spooner Oldham, and 2:30 p.m. panel discussion with Candi Staton, Linda Hall, keyboardist <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/life\/2025\/06\/the-story-of-muscle-shoals-great-unsung-studio-band-we-were-doing-something-different.html\">Clayton Ivey<\/a> and musician\/recording engineer Marlin Greene. A 1 p.m. November 16 musician spotlight features Mac McAnnaly. More info at <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.countrymusichalloffame.org\/calendar\/muscle-shoals-low-rhythm-rising?vgo_ee=3l5Rfq820tQJCMSAAQGHEJ2iWCwekVU828pksQ%3D%3D%3AcYYAb8cdbDKglsnXl9H0FICHGSLcnj0u\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\">countrymusichalloffame.org.<\/a><\/p>\n<p class=\"article__paragraph article__paragraph--left\" id=\"BB4FCBXCWNATJDZ4RF4S636R3A\">Smith says, \u201cOne thing we like to do is think about what exhibits are up at any given time and the balance. Right now we have a <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/Dolly%20Parton\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"\" title=\"https:\/\/www.al.com\/topic\/Dolly%20Parton\/\">Dolly Parton<\/a> exhibit. And maybe that\u2019ll draw people in the door, but while they\u2019re here, they\u2019re going to learn about who David Hood is.\u201d<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p>If you purchase a product or register for an account through a link on our site, we may receive compensation.<span> By using this site, you consent to our <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.advancelocal.com\/advancelocalUserAgreement\/user-agreement.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">User Agreement<\/a> and agree that your clicks, interactions, and personal information may be collected, recorded, and\/or stored by us and social media and other third-party partners in accordance with our <a rel=\"nofollow\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.advancelocal.com\/advancelocalUserAgreement\/privacy-policy.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Privacy Policy.<\/a><\/span><\/p>\n<p><em> \u2018 The preceding article may include information circulated by third parties \u2019 <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em> \u2018 Some details of this article were extracted from the following source www.al.com \u2019 <\/em><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The Country Music Hall of Fame wasn\u2019t sure they were going to get the piano.
